Crawl Space Encapsulation in Davis Wharf

In our area, many of the homes are built with crawl spaces instead of basements. As long as there have been crawl spaces, they were created with open vents which was intended to increase fresh air flow through the space and keep it dry. Unfortunately, the opposite is usually what happens. Having open vents allows water to get in when it rains or snows and the vents prevent proper evaporation which results in the humidity level staying too high which will eventually harbor the growth of mildew. Up to ½ of the air in your home has come up through the crawl space so ensuring the crawl space is protected from the outside and controlling excess humidity will improve the overall air quality in your home.

We have been dealing with crawl spaces since 1995 and we know the proper way to seal them off and control excess humidity. We do this using a method called encapsulation which is the installation of a heavy duty liner, occasionally installed with insulation products, and are strong plastic and vinyl sheets as well as vent covers and a heavy duty door that will close off the area completely and stop any excess moisture from entering. Encapsulation will also stop rodents and animals from getting in your crawl space which will help keep any items there safe and allow you to use it for storage. Once the crawl space is encapsulated, if necessary we will install a system of sagging floor jacks to stabilize sinking floors in your home.

Foundation Settlement Repair Davis Wharf

Your foundation is quite possibly one of the most important parts. It not only holds the building itself but it also is the basement walls. When there are foundation problems, they will generally show themselves in the form of stair-step cracks in the brickwork, cracks that run the length of the foundation or along basement walls. You may also notice that the doors or windows will get stuck or even cracks at the corners of them. You may not think these issues seem problematic when you notice them, they are all indicators of a sinking or settling foundation and it is important to have an expert evaluate the foundation for particular problems and determine what type of a repair needs to be in place.

It is good that the most common foundation problems stem from similar issues and our professionals are very good at noticing those issues. We can utilize a repair product that is for your exact problem to permanently repair and stabilize the foundation or walls. If there is a sinking foundation, we will install a system of foundation piers to level the foundation. Depending on how bad it is and where it is, we will use either helical piers or push piers. Both types of piers are very strong and are able to stabilize your foundation.
